Front Ball Joint: Installation

  1. Insert the ball joint into housing.

    Tightening torque (Bolt): 

    50 N.m (5.1 kgf-m, 36.9 ft-lb) 

    CAUTION: Do not apply grease to the tapered portion of ball stud.
  2. Install the ball joint into front arm.

    Tightening torque (castle nut): 

    Front arm: 

    45 N.m (4.6 kgf-m, 33.2 ft-lb) 

  3. Retighten the castle nut further up to 60° until the hole in the ball stud is aligned with a slot in castle nut. Then, insert a new cotter pin and bend it around the castle nut.
  4. Install the stabilizer bracket.

    Tightening torque: 

    25 N.m (2.5 kgf-m, 18.1 ft-lb) 

  5. Install the front wheels.
